As an investor, it’s crucial to understand that the market doesn’t have just two stages – buying and selling. The “sit and wait” stage is a time to hold off on buying or selling and wait for a correction. When the market or specific sectors pull back, the correction tends to be severe, with sectors shedding 50% or more of their value.

The key is to wait for technical indicators to signal a strong buy before making any moves. If technical indicators pull back to oversold ranges, the trend indicator remains positive, and bullish sentiment drops, it’s time to back the truck up and buy. The markets experience a correction almost every year. In most instances, when the bullish sentiment soars past the 55 park several times over 60 days, the market almost always lets out a decent dose of steam. Patience and disciple: Key traits to winning the  game

In the trading world, many investors tend to lack patience and discipline. Instead, they rely on fear and euphoria to guide their trading decisions, often leading to mediocre gains or significant losses. However, the key to successful trading is to have a systematic approach that revolves around patience and discipline.
